Jos Buttler was on fire against Delhi Capitals in IPL 2022. The right-handed batter hit his third century of the ongoing season. His 116 runs came off 65 balls, with the help of 9 fours and the same number of sixes.
He is the first player to cross 450 runs in the 15th season and also equalled Wasim Jaffer’s long-standing record.
According to famous statistician Kausthub Gudipati, Buttler is the second player after Jaffer to score a hundred on all these Mumbai grounds in top-tier cricket (Wankhede, Brabourne, DY Patil).
After Shikhar Dhawan, the 31-year-old England player is the second player to accumulate back-to-back hundreds in one IPL season.
